The Shift: From “More Content” to “Better Answers”
For years, the dominant SEO strategy was simple: publish longer content, cover every possible angle, and aim to become the “ultimate guide” on a topic. Larger brands with bigger teams and budgets naturally had an advantage in this model.
But AI systems are changing that dynamic. Instead of rewarding the most comprehensive page, they are prioritizing the most relevant and precise answer. Pages that clearly match the user’s query, use aligned headings, and stay focused on solving one problem are more likely to be cited.
This fundamentally levels the playing field. A well-structured, 1,000-word page created by a local business in Navi Mumbai can outperform a massive, generic guide written by a national brand-if it answers the question better.

The Power of Precision: One Page, One Problem
One of the most important insights from the study is that focused pages consistently outperform broader ones. This challenges the traditional idea of creating one large “services” page and expecting it to rank for everything.
Instead, think of your content as a series of answers to very specific customer questions.
For example, a local clinic shouldn’t just have a page titled “Our Services.” It should also have content that directly addresses questions like “How to find a good dentist in Nerul?” or “What is the cost of dental implants in Navi Mumbai?”
Each of these pages becomes a highly relevant answer to a real query. And because it is focused, it has a higher chance of being picked up not just by search engines, but by AI systems as well.

Structure Still Matters- But Only to Support Clarity
While content structure plays a role, it’s not the primary driver. The study showed that elements like subheadings and schema markup can improve performance, but only marginally compared to relevance and focus.
What really matters is how easily your content communicates the answer.
A well-performing blog typically:
Uses clear, question-based headings
Breaks information into digestible sections
Avoids unnecessary complexity
For small businesses, this is good news. You don’t need advanced technical setups to compete. You just need clarity.
Timing and Consistency: The Overlooked Factors
Another important insight is that content doesn’t perform at its peak immediately. Pages tend to perform best after 30 to 90 days, once they’ve had time to build visibility and signals.
This means two things for local businesses:
First, patience is essential. Publishing a blog and expecting instant results is unrealistic.
Second, consistency matters more than one-time effort. A steady flow of focused, relevant content will always outperform occasional large pieces.
